Stone Wall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Stone wall hardscaping services involve the construction and installation of durable, aesthetically appealing walls made from natural stone, retaining wall blocks, or other sturdy materials. These structures are commonly used to define property boundaries, create terraced gardens, prevent soil erosion, or add decorative elements to outdoor spaces. Property owners often request stone wall hardscaping for both functional purposes, such as leveling uneven terrain, and aesthetic enhancements, like adding a rustic or classic look to landscaping features.
Before requesting stone wall hardscaping services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of materials suitable for their landscape, the structural requirements, and the overall design options. It is helpful to consider the intended purpose of the wall, whether for support, privacy, or visual appeal, as well as any local regulations or property restrictions that may influence the project. Clear communication about goals and site conditions can ensure the final result aligns with the property's needs and aesthetic preferences.

Common Stone Wall Hardscaping Jobs
Retaining walls - designed to hold back soil and prevent erosion around landscaping features.
Stone patios - create durable, attractive outdoor living spaces for relaxing and entertaining.
Garden walls - define planting areas and add structure to landscape designs.
Fire pits and outdoor fireplaces - enhance outdoor gatherings with functional and aesthetic features.
Walkways and paths - provide safe, long-lasting routes through gardens and yards.
Custom stone features - add unique character and visual interest to residential landscapes.
Stone Wall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for stone wall hardscaping? Stone wall hardscaping can be used for retaining walls, garden borders, and decorative features to enhance property aesthetics and functionality.
What materials are commonly used in stone wall hardscaping? Common materials include natural stone, stacked stone, and concrete blocks, chosen for durability and visual appeal.
How does stone wall hardscaping improve a property? It adds structural support, defines outdoor spaces, and increases curb appeal with a timeless, natural look.
What maintenance is required for stone walls? Regular inspection for damage and cleaning to prevent buildup help maintain the integrity and appearance of stone walls.
